Flat Tires

When a Goodyear tire goes flat it should be removed immediately to be inspected and repaired. If you drive on a tire for a short distance the tire could be permanently ruined. Even driving a short distance can ruin a tire. Punctures that are smaller than ¼ inch can usually be related. Larger punctures or holes cannot be usually repaired. Sidewall punctures should never be repaired and the tire should be replaced.

Balance Your Tires

Goodyear tires should always be balanced when they are first installed on new rims. They should also be balanced whenever you feel a vibration in the steering wheel or the car in general. Continued vibration may harm the tires and cause them to overheat or wear unevenly. Some tire companies suggest that the tires should be balanced at least once per year.

Prior to Hardwood Floors Being Installed

Consumers can save money by removing the existing flooring and arranging for disposal. Once the old flooring is removed, vacuum the floor and remove any staples and smooth rough areas to provide a level floor for the installer. This is the time to test your floor for squeaks. Consumers can either screw nail the existing sub floor to the joists in locations were the floor is squeaking or install added sub flooring to act as an additional stabilizer for the floor. Some people feel that a squeaky hardwood floor adds to the character of a home. Other consumers cannot stand the sound of a squeaky floor, so pay attention to this step if this bothers you.

The installers will install the sub floor and they will install the hardwood floor for you. Once this is completed the next step is to install the corner round around the perimeter of the floor and paint it whatever color you select. We suggest that the corner round should be painted prior to installation since it is much easier to paint a long strip of wood that is not attached to another surface of a different color. Nail holes and any other marks can be repaired once it is installed.

Paint First

We also suggest that if you do plan to paint the walls that this work be completed before the new floor is installed. The painting can be done much more quickly. Especially when there is no need to worry about paint droplets on the floor.

Smart Hydro Meters

Smart Hydro MetersWe have a smart hydro meters installed on our neighborhood. This meter records the amount of power we use every hour and then reports this usage to the company that provides the electricity to consumers in our area. We are billed on the amount of electricity we consume during the day and evening at different rates. During the daytime, we are on a peak rate level. In the early morning and early evening, we are on mid-peak rate, while at night we are on an off-peak rate. The difference in rates between peak and off-peak can be almost half price. The utility in our area has gone this route to encourage consumers to reduce energy use and reduce their electricity bills. Most people now will cook in the evening, dry their clothes in the dryer, etc during off-peak time frames.

Problems with Smart Hydro Meters

This summer we found that our meter was not reporting the usage to the company providing our electricity properly. We were notified that it had to be changed. This change took a few months to implement. Not sure if it is red tape or they are just too busy. However, it was over these summer months when usage is at the highest level for air conditioning and pool pumps. We decided we would continue to practice energy reduction techniques during the summertime much as we normally do. It turns out that this was a good approach to take.

Turns out that although the meter was not reporting the usage to the company, it was still recording our usage. When the meter was replaced, they took it into the lab and downloaded the usage of their computers. They were then able to reconstruct the billing for us and sent us a new bill.

We had been billed up to that point as if our usage was all on the low peak rate. Which of course is to our advantage. This is not to be expected in the long run. We were reassessed. Over a 3 month period, we had consumed an additional $421 dollars of electricity. We now had a bill for this much usage.

We are now challenging this bill to make sure that they calculated the amount correctly, however, I am prepared to pay the electricity as calculated, since we probably used it.

The reason for this post is to point out to reads a couple of things about smart meters:

  • Be aware that they record the results all of the time even if they do not report the results
  • You will get a bill eventually for the proper amount of electricity
  • Practice energy reduction techniques all of the time
  • Challenge your utility to demonstrate how they calculated the final invoice

Acclimatize the Hardwood

Most hardwood stores and installers will tell you that the wood should be delivered a week ahead of time. It should be allowed to acclimatize to the home and the conditions in the home. This allows the wood to expand if needed. Also to also absorb humidity or dry out as the case may be. If your home is really dry or if humid, you may want to allow for more time.
